Building Site Clearing Services

Building site clearing involves the removal of existing structures, vegetation, debris, and other obstructions to prepare a piece of land for construction or development projects. This service typically includes tasks such as tree and shrub removal, debris hauling, grubbing, and sometimes grading to create a level surface. The goal is to create a clean, accessible, and safe environment that meets the requirements of future construction plans.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to efficiently clear the land while minimizing disturbance to the surrounding area.

This service addresses several common problems encountered during the initial stages of development. Overgrown vegetation, fallen trees, and accumulated debris can hinder construction progress and pose safety hazards on the site. Additionally, existing structures or remnants of previous developments may need to be removed to comply with zoning regulations or project specifications. Clearing the land also helps identify any underlying issues, such as unstable soil or underground utilities, that may need to be addressed before building begins.

Various types of properties utilize site clearing services, including residential plots, commercial lots, industrial sites, and public infrastructure projects. Residential properties often require clearing for new home construction, landscaping, or renovations. Commercial and industrial properties may need extensive clearing to prepare for warehouses, retail spaces, or factories. Public sector projects, such as parks, schools, or transportation infrastructure, also benefit from thorough site clearing to ensure safe and accessible development.

Labor Costs - Labor expenses for building site clearing typically range from $25 to $50 per hour per worker, depending on project complexity. For a small lot, total labor costs may be around $500 to $1,500. Larger or more complex sites can require significant labor investment, increasing overall costs.

Equipment Fees - Equipment rental fees, including bulldozers, excavators, and loaders, generally range from $200 to $600 per day. The total cost depends on the size of the site and the machinery needed, with larger projects incurring higher equipment rental expenses.

Permitting and Disposal - Costs for permits and debris disposal services can vary from $300 to $1,000 or more. Disposal fees depend on the volume of debris, while permits may be required for certain sites or local regulations, adding to the overall expense.

Project Size and Scope - The total cost of site clearing services varies based on the size and complexity of the project. Small residential lots might cost between $1,000 and $3,000, whereas larger commercial sites could range from $5,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
